Educational discourse treats school as a bounded system, an institutional shell waiting to be filled by the actions of teachers and administrators. However, as schools become more open through the impact of technology and the influence of societal change, the narrowness of this reality is changing. This book suggests that pedagogical communities should be understood in their wider meaning, not only certain school, but all the border-crossing networked communities. Regarding this, also teachers? professional development is seen innovatively as relationship-based professional development. This development cannot be considered separate from social networks and the development of collaborative learning technologies. Instead, they should be seen as the elements of teachers? intelligent networks which include members of pedagogical communities, learning technologies, media and information sources, and in which teachers exchange information and create new knowledge in order to develop their profession. This book is especially useful to the e-learning specialists, educational professionals, authorities and change makers.
